A battery of 3.0 V is connected to a resistor dissipating 0.5 W of power. If the terminal voltage of the battery is 2.5 V , the power dissipated within the internal resistance is:

Options

  1. A0. 50   W
  2. B0. 072   W
  3. C0.10   W
  4. D0. 125   W

Correct answer

C. 0.10   W

Step-by-step solution

Given, Emf of the battery, E = 3   V Potential difference across resister R is V R = 2 . 5   V Power dissipation in the resister is P = 0 . 5   W By using Kirchhoff's voltage law is given by, V r + V R = E     . . . ( 1 ) V r is voltage across internal resister.
